And for those in the dark, AMIT Bhatia has responded to rumours that he could be leaving Loftus Road. Rumours have surfaced in recent weeks that the Vice Chairman could be set to step down, but Bhatia has taken to Twitter to quash the speculation. Returning from holiday he stated via his account (Amit_Bhatia99): 'I'm very much alive and have no plans of going anywhere anytime soon. 'When the time comes to move on I will have to. But for now there's loads still to be done at #QPR. We're only 4 games into the season! ' This will come as welcome news to QPR fans who have bombarded the son-in-law of Lakshmi Mittal with queries and messages of support. Vital QPR.
